The neighborhood of Odessa, Delaware … an official Delaware “Must-Do” according to Delaware Today Magazine ... is located just north of Dover, the state’s capital. This historic hidden gem is a unique area many love to escape to. Known as Cantwell’s Bridge until 1855, Odessa developed as a bustling grain port and played a vital role in Delaware’s early commercial growth. Today, this tranquil town with pristine colonial buildings, tree-lined streets, brick sidewalks, and a population slightly exceeding 300 seems untouched by time. Saturdays at the Hearth
Bring the whole family and explore the role of children in the colonial kitchen and garden. Explore the Collins-Sharp House as costumed interpreters capture the flavors of authentic 18th-century cooking. Savor the sights and aromas of spring dishes cooked over an open fire using the tools, recipes and techniques common in colonial Odessa.
